Hotels in Philadelphia
Quality Inn Philadelphia
Location. The Holiday Inn Express Philadelphia Choctaw is located in Philadelphia, Miss. Two miles f...
The Westin Philadelphia
Located in the heart of the city known as America's birthplace, The Westin Philadelphia Hotel combin...
Loews Hotel Philadelphia
Location. The Loews Hotel Philadelphia offers a prime location in downtown Philadelphia, one block f...
Econo Lodge Airport Hotel
Location. The Econo Lodge Airport Hotel is located in Philadelphia, Pa. Two miles from the Philadelp...